Spicy Chicken Tenders

  • Total Time: 35 minutes
  • Yield: Serves approximately 4 people 1x

Ingredients

  • 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ts (about 1.5 lbs), cut into strips
  • 3 cloves fresh garlic, minced
  • 1 cup panko breadcrumbs
  • 2 tbsp hot sauce (adjust to taste)
  • 2 large eggs, beaten
  • 1 tsp paprika
  • 1 tsp salt
  • ½ tsp black pepper

Instructions

  1. 1.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  2. 2. Cut chicken breasts into strips about 1 inch wide.
  3. 3. In a small bowl, mix paprika, salt, and pepper.
  4. 4. Set up three bowls: one with beaten eggs, one with panko mixed with half of the spice blend, and one for the remaining spice blend.
  5. 5. Dip each chicken strip in egg wash, coat with the spice mix, then roll in panko breadcrumbs.
  6. 6. Place breaded chicken on the baking sheet in a single layer and bake for about 20 minutes until golden brown and cooked through.
  • Prep Time: 15 minutes
  • Cook Time: 20 minutes
